Crystallization
| Crystalization Experiments | ||||
|---|---|---|---|---|
| ID | Method | pH | Temperature | Details |
| 1 | VAPOR DIFFUSION, HANGING DROP | 8.5 | 291 | PEG 4000, TRIS, Lithium Chloride, Glucose-1-phosphate., pH 8.5, VAPOR DIFFUSION, HANGING DROP, temperature 291K |
